Session Description: According to the Social Progress Index, the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) will not be achieved until 2094—64 years after the deadline set by the UN. The effects of this delay will be devastating for billions and lead to irreversible environmental damage. Acceleration of progress is urgently needed. In comes Catalyst 2030.

Catalyst 2030 is a global collaborative multi-stakeholder movement initiated by leading social entrepreneurs from Ashoka, Echoing Green, Schwab, Skoll and others from some of the most prestigious global networks of social innovators. The group is inclusive and rapidly expanding to include governments, funders, bilaterals, multilaterals, and other intermediaries from across the globe.

Catalyst 2030 members have come together to accelerate progress towards the SDGs by radically transforming the social sector to adopt systems change approaches and by propelling systems change at a country level. Together, the aim is to drive a significant dent in the climate crisis, the reduction of poverty and to leave a lasting and positive impact on the lives of many millions of people.
